a couple things.
1. you don't need ethernet to update manual. its recommended but you can do it over wifi.
https://kb.netgear.com/23960/How-do-I-manually-update-the-firmware-on-my-NETGEAR-router
2. that router won't hit gigabit speeds over wifi. It will over wired. Here's some realistic speedtesting info from smallnetbuilder (reputable site) on how that router performed https://www.smallnetbuilder.com/wireless/wireless-reviews/32239-ac1900-first-look-netgear-r7000-a-asus-rt-ac68u
3. what wired speeds are you getting? (hint, the built in speedtest isn't accurate).
4. how are you testing those speeds?
